- Abstract
- We have investigated the limit-cycle region of a short-pulse free electron laser (FEL) oscillator system. Using properly defined collective phase variables, we describe the electron dynamics and the phase evolution of the optical field in the limit-cycle region. In this research, we have observed that electrons can be detrapped from the ponderomotive bucket due to the spatial variation of the optical field, and we concluded that the limit-cycle oscillation of the short-pulse FEL oscillator system is a consequence of the electron detrapping.
